Dallas sets new Hospitality & Contract Design Show

-- Home Accents Today, 5/1/2010 12:00:00 AM

Dallas Market Center has announced that the new Dallas Hospitality & Contract Design Show (June 24-27) to be held in conjunction with the Dallas Total Home & Gift Market (June 23-29) will present thousands of product lines for the built environment as well as hold a variety of educational opportunities.

Daily seminars, trend forecasts and walking tours presented by leading designers and tailored to the contract and hospitality design industries will be offered. “Dallas Market Center is a smart choice for buyers because we offer more products, across more categories all under one roof,” said Bill Winsor, president and CEO, Dallas Market Center. “With relevant educational opportunities that target the needs of members of the hospitality and contract design industry, the show offers more bang for their buck.”

The new Dallas Hospitality & Contract Design show invites designers with large-scale projects in hospitality, workplace, institutional and government environments to shop for the built environment. Thousands of product lines will be available from permanent and temporary exhibitions including: lighting, decorative accessories, interior and outdoor furniture, permanent floral, artwork, bath and bedding, rugs, tabletop, and many other categories.
